Kanboard features and specs

  • Open Source
    Kanboard is open-source software, allowing users to freely access, modify, and distribute the source code. This provides flexibility and control over the tool's features and security.
  • Simple and Lightweight
    Kanboard has a minimalist and straightforward design, which makes it easy to use and requires low resources to operate effectively.
  • Self-Hosted Option
    Users have the option to host Kanboard on their own servers, which provides greater control over data privacy and system management.
  • Customizable Workflows
    Kanboard allows for the creation of custom workflows, enabling teams to tailor the task management process to their specific needs.
  • Extensions and Plugins
    The platform supports various plugins and integrations, enhancing its functionality and allowing users to extend the tool's capabilities.
  • Task Management Features
    Kanboard includes essential task management features like task prioritization, commenting, assigning tasks, and setting due dates.

Possible disadvantages of Kanboard

  • Limited Advanced Features
    Compared to other project management tools, Kanboard may lack some advanced features such as detailed reporting, time tracking, and complex dependencies.
  • User Interface
    The UI, while simple, can be perceived as too basic or outdated compared to more modern project management tools, potentially impacting user experience.
  • Learning Curve for Non-Tech Users
    Non-technical users might find it challenging to set up and customize, especially if they need to implement self-hosting or advanced configurations.
  • Limited Support
    Being an open-source project, it might not have the same level of dedicated customer support that comes with commercial project management tools.
  • Plugin Reliability
    Since many plugins are community-developed, their quality and reliability can vary, and they may not always be fully maintained or compatible with the latest versions.
  • Documentation
    The available documentation might not be as comprehensive or as user-friendly as that provided by larger, commercial platforms.

Analysis of Kanboard

Overall verdict

  • Kanboard is a strong choice for those looking for a simple, customizable project management tool that embraces the Kanban method. Its open-source nature and focus on privacy and control make it a good fit for users who prefer self-hosted solutions. However, it might not be ideal for large teams or enterprises with complex project management needs, as it lacks some of the advanced features offered by other tools.

Why this product is good

  • Kanboard is an open-source project management software that focuses on simplicity and efficiency. It uses a Kanban methodology, which is great for visualizing tasks and workflow. It is highly customizable, allowing users to tailor it to their needs, and it supports plugins for additional functionality. The tool is lightweight and self-hosted, providing users with full control over their data. Additionally, it is free to use, which makes it appealing for small teams or individuals with limited budgets.

  • Show HN: VS Code Agent Kanban: Task Management for the AI-Assisted Developer
    I think a container of Kanboard https://kanboard.org/ and an MCP integration would achieve something similar - mostly cause when I think of project management tools that is the only one that actually feels insanely snappy, compared to the slowness of Jira, OpenProject and tbh Trello is also slower. Would actually be cool to have more local tools like that, that something like Claude Code can integrate with. Find a... - Source: Hacker News / 5 months ago
  • Kan.bn โ€“ An open-source alterative to Trello
    Https://kanboard.org ist better for self hosting. Runs on any cheap LAMP. - Source: Hacker News / about 1 year ago
  • Kan.bn โ€“ An open-source alterative to Trello
    Some years ago, I used Kanboard (it written in php): https://kanboard.org/ . It was ugly but useful (and easy to install because I remember that it didn't need any data base). - Source: Hacker News / about 1 year ago
  • Kan.bn โ€“ An open-source alterative to Trello
    How does it compare to the existing open-source boards, such as: https://wekan.github.io/ https://taiga.io/ https://kanboard.org/. - Source: Hacker News / about 1 year ago
  • Show HN: ExpenseOwl โ€“ simple and beautiful self-hostedexpense tracker
    This reminds me of Kanboard in how focused and simple it is: https://kanboard.org That's a really good thing, you don't always need heavyweight solutions with bunches of features that love to eat a lot of RAM (and CPU), sometimes a simpler option is fully sufficient. Especially because this one doesn't try to tackle complex problems like auth, if it's for personal use, you can just put basicauth (over TLS), mTLS,... - Source: Hacker News / over 1 year ago
